Well, one rule would be to treat everyone civilly.

Two...you probably should not have hit the bills I sent you - there's no rule against it...but when I trade with others here (and here mail trades are allowed) the understanding is that thetraded bills are not hit by the parties involved. Because you are new here, you would not have known that...so no biggie.

Generally, you should, as with WG? - enter bills as the zipcode your butt is planted in at the moment of entry. We, too, like accuracy in tracking.

Generally, you should have posession of bills you enter, but I am not sure if there is a hard and fast rule on this.

There are no restrictions on user notes, although PG-13 is encouraged. If something especially offensive shows up, ping Markus and ask him to remove the comment.

Scoring is quite a bit different here. 1 point for each bill entered. 1 point plus a factor depending on your current hit rate when a bill gets hit.
